THROWBACK THURSDAY: Outkast - Roses


God damn was this my jam back in the day. I miss this shit. Remember when this was hip-hop and popular music? Not this Justin Beiber and Ke$$$hhaaa shit we have now. How creative was this whole album. Outkast was the group, it was two dudes: Andre 3000 & Big Boi, divided into the jock clan (speakerboxx) and the theatre kids (the love below). The result: the perfect clash of badass and and heart throb. It's like if Rick Ross and Ne-Yo made a collabo album. I absolutely love the music video too. So creative, so good.
